MANILA (Reuters) -A volcano in central Philippines erupted on Monday, spewing plumes of up to 5,000 metres (16,404.2 feet) high, the country's seismology agency said.
The lowest alert level remained on Mt. Kanlaon in the Philippine province of Negros Oriental, with the level unchanged for several days leading up to the eruption, the Philippine Institute of Volcanology and Seismology (Phivolcs) said in an advisory.

(Reuters) - A court in Pakistan has overturned the prison sentence of jailed former Prime Minister Imran Khan on Monday in a case pertaining to the leaking of state secrets, local broadcaster ARY news and his lawyer said.
Khan, 71, was previously handed a 10-year prison sentence by a lower court in the case on charges of making public a classified cable sent to Islamabad by Pakistan's ambassador in Washington in 2022.
(Reuters) - Nvidia led global companies in market cap gains in May, buoyed by a stunning rally as its bumper revenue forecast reinforced investor confidence in the AI-driven surge in chip demand.
Nvidia's market cap soared to $2.69 trillion at the end of May, marking a nearly 25% increase during the month, as the announcement of its stock split further boosted investor enthusiasm.
